Tarun Kumar Rawat ’s Digital Signal Processing (Oxford University Press) is widely regarded as a student-friendly alternative to more rigorous "classics" like Oppenheim. It is praised for its step-by-step approach and its high volume of practical, solved examples that help students prepare for exams and real-world engineering tasks. 📘 Key Features & Content

The book is structured into 17 chapters and is noted for several pedagogical strengths:

Massive Problem Set: Includes over 600 solved examples, 230 MCQs, and 180 end-of-chapter problems.

MATLAB Integration: Contains solved MATLAB programs and dedicated sections on using MATLAB to implement filter design algorithms.

Comprehensive Scope: Covers fundamental topics (sampling, Z-transforms, DFT/FFT) and advanced subjects like Multirate DSP, Optimum Linear (Wiener) Filters, and Finite Word Length Effects.
